AIRPORT REMARKS

Operational remarks

FOR RECORD PURPOSES ONLY.
FOR CD CTC DENVER ARTCC AT 303-651-4257.
OTR CTC: RICHARD MANN; 719-689-5641.
60-FOOT PLINES SW 3/10 MILE.
ACTVT LGTG - 123.050. IF REMOTE LGTG FAILS CALL 719-640-7367.
